Alexander Povetkin knocks out Carlos Takam in 10th round
Alexander Povetkin didn’t have the hottest start today in Moscow, but he dug down deep and fought with serious determination, eventually overpowering Carlos Takam with a knockdown in round nine, and a knockout in round 10.

Povetkin (28-1, 20 KO) had a tough go of it in the first four rounds, as Takam (30-2-1, 23 KO) was able to outbox the former amateur superstar, working behind a jab and landing good power shots that kept Povetkin’s own offense largely neutralized. But Povetkin made some adjustments in the middle rounds, and by the end of round eight, had evened it up on the judges’ scorecards. The WBC open scores were read at 76-76 for all three judges, and this was a case where the open scoring arguably made a fight better.
